N.Y. localities hurt as Indian casino cash dries up

31 July 2012

The Associated Press reports that the struggling municipalities in western and northern New York are collateral damage in a high-stakes confrontation between the state and Indian tribes involving gambling dollars.

According to the AP report, the Seneca and Mohawk tribes have for years withheld casino payments to the state, claiming that New York violated contracts with the tribes by allowing gambling in their exclusive territories. Consequently, the state stopped sending money — more than $100 million so far — to municipalities where Indian casinos operate.
